Discourse
specializedDiscourse is a modern open-source forum platform delivering engaging discussions with real-time features and mobile responsiveness.
Real-time 'heartbeat' system with WebSockets for instant notifications and live updates without page refreshes
Discourse is an open-source forum software that powers modern online communities with a sleek, mobile-responsive interface and real-time features. It excels in fostering engaging discussions through infinite scroll, powerful full-text search, categories, tags, and gamification like badges and leaderboards. As a complete replacement for legacy bulletin boards, it integrates seamlessly with tools like Slack, GitHub, and email notifications.
Pros
- Exceptional modern UI with real-time updates and mobile optimization
- Highly extensible with plugins, themes, and API integrations
- Robust moderation tools, user trust levels, and analytics
Cons
- Self-hosting requires technical expertise (Docker/Ruby setup)
- Resource-intensive on shared hosting
- Steeper admin learning curve for advanced customizations
Best For
Growing online communities, teams, and organizations seeking a scalable, engaging forum platform.
NodeBB
specializedNodeBB is a Node.js-based forum software offering real-time chat, notifications, and extensible plugins for dynamic communities.
Socket.io-powered real-time interactions for live updates, notifications, and chat without page refreshes
NodeBB is a modern, open-source forum software built on Node.js, designed for creating dynamic, real-time discussion communities with features like infinite scroll, live notifications, and a fully responsive interface. It supports threaded discussions, user groups, private messaging, and extensive customization through plugins and themes. Ideal for tech-savvy administrators seeking scalable, engaging forum experiences beyond traditional bulletin boards.
Pros
- Real-time features like live notifications and composer for seamless user engagement
- Highly extensible with thousands of plugins and themes from the Node.js ecosystem
- Excellent performance and scalability for large communities
Cons
- Self-hosting requires Node.js and server administration knowledge
- Smaller community and support resources compared to legacy forum software
- Some advanced features depend on third-party plugins
Best For
Tech communities and developers who want a customizable, real-time forum with modern UX.
Flarum
specializedFlarum provides a fast, lightweight, and beautifully designed forum solution with infinite scrolling and modern UI.
Real-time notifications and infinite scrolling for a seamless, native app-like user experience
Flarum is a free, open-source forum software that delivers a modern, lightweight, and highly performant discussion platform built on PHP with a reactive JavaScript frontend. It emphasizes speed, elegance, and simplicity, featuring real-time updates, infinite scrolling, and a mobile-first responsive design. Highly extensible through a vast library of community extensions, it's ideal for creating engaging online communities without the bloat of heavier alternatives.
Pros
- Lightning-fast performance with real-time updates
- Beautiful, modern, app-like interface out of the box
- Highly extensible via Composer-based extensions
- Fully responsive and mobile-optimized
Cons
- Core features are minimal, relying heavily on extensions
- Installation requires server-side technical knowledge (PHP, Composer)
- Smaller community and ecosystem than established competitors
- Documentation can be inconsistent for advanced customizations
Best For
Tech-savvy administrators and small-to-medium communities seeking a sleek, high-performance forum without resource-intensive overhead.
Invision Community
enterpriseInvision Community is a comprehensive suite for building forums, blogs, and social networks with advanced customization.
The Pages app builder, allowing creation of fully custom applications and content types without coding
Invision Community is a comprehensive, self-hosted platform for building robust online communities, offering core forum functionality alongside integrated blogs, galleries, social features, and a CMS. It provides extensive customization through themes, plugins, and the powerful Pages app builder for creating custom content types. Designed for scalability, it supports large user bases with advanced moderation, SEO tools, and mobile apps.
Pros
- Exceptionally feature-rich with forums, blogs, galleries, and commerce integration
- Highly customizable via themes, plugins, and app builder
- Scalable for large communities with strong performance and admin tools
Cons
- Steep learning curve for setup and advanced customization
- Subscription pricing can be expensive for small sites
- Resource-intensive, requiring decent server specs
Best For
Medium to large communities or businesses seeking a professional, all-in-one community platform with deep customization.
Vanilla Forums
specializedVanilla is an open-source discussion forum platform emphasizing simplicity, themes, and addon ecosystem.
Seamless website embedding for integrated community experiences
Vanilla Forums is an open-source forum software designed for building modern, customizable online communities with features like threaded discussions, Q&A modes, reactions, and user profiles. It supports both self-hosted installations and managed cloud hosting, allowing seamless integration and embedding into existing websites. With a vast library of plugins and themes, it caters to diverse community needs from casual forums to professional support sites.
Pros
- Highly customizable with thousands of plugins and themes
- Modern, responsive design optimized for mobile
- Free open-source core with strong embedding capabilities
Cons
- Self-hosting requires technical setup and maintenance
- Cloud plans can become expensive for large communities
- Smaller active community compared to top competitors like Discourse
Best For
Small to medium communities or businesses wanting a flexible, embeddable forum with low entry costs.
phpBB
specializedphpBB is a robust, free open-source bulletin board with extensive styles, extensions, and multilingual support.
Extensive ecosystem of community-driven extensions and styles for endless customization
phpBB is a free, open-source forum software written in PHP that enables users to create and manage online discussion communities with threaded discussions, user permissions, and multimedia support. It offers robust administrative tools for moderation, private messaging, and forum customization. With a large community, it supports extensive extensions and styles for tailored experiences.
Pros
- Completely free and open-source with no licensing costs
- Highly customizable via thousands of extensions and styles
- Proven security and reliability from over 20 years of development
Cons
- Default interface feels dated compared to modern alternatives
- Steep learning curve for advanced customization and administration
- Requires self-hosting and technical setup knowledge
Best For
Tech-savvy administrators and communities seeking a free, highly extensible forum without ongoing costs.
MyBB
specializedMyBB offers a feature-rich open-source forum software with plugins, themes, and strong community management tools.
Extensive plugin system with over 1,000 free plugins for endless customization without core modifications
MyBB is a free, open-source PHP-based forum software designed for creating customizable online discussion communities. It offers core features like threaded forums, private messaging, user permissions, attachments, and search functionality, with extensive support for themes and plugins. Ideal for self-hosted environments, it emphasizes flexibility and performance for medium to large communities.
Pros
- Completely free and open-source with no licensing costs
- Vast plugin and theme ecosystem for high customization
- Strong performance and active community support
Cons
- Dated default interface requiring theme tweaks
- Steep learning curve for installation and advanced setup
- Manual security updates and maintenance needed
Best For
Tech-savvy administrators and communities seeking a no-cost, highly customizable self-hosted forum solution.
bbPress
specializedbbPress is a lightweight WordPress plugin for creating simple, efficient forums integrated with WordPress sites.
Native WordPress integration, sharing the same user database, themes, and admin interface
bbPress is a free, open-source forum plugin designed specifically for WordPress, allowing users to easily add lightweight discussion forums to their websites. It supports threaded topics, replies, user roles, moderation tools, and anonymous posting options. Fully integrated with WordPress, it leverages the platform's users, themes, and SEO capabilities for a seamless experience.
Pros
- Seamless integration with WordPress users, themes, and plugins
- Lightweight and fast performance
- Completely free and open-source with strong community support
Cons
- Lacks advanced features like private messaging or rich media embeds
- Basic default interface requires theme customization
- Limited scalability for very large communities without extensions
Best For
WordPress site owners and small to medium communities seeking simple, integrated forum functionality.
Simple Machines Forum
specializedSMF is a free professional-grade forum software focused on speed, security, and ease of use.
The built-in package manager for seamless installation and management of thousands of community mods and themes
Simple Machines Forum (SMF) is a free, open-source PHP-based forum software designed for creating and managing online discussion communities. It offers core features like threaded discussions, user permissions, private messaging, and anti-spam tools, with support for MySQL databases. Highly customizable through thousands of community-created themes and modifications, SMF emphasizes lightweight performance and ease of installation on standard web hosts.
Pros
- Completely free and open-source with no licensing costs
- Lightweight and fast-performing even on shared hosting
- Extensive library of mods and themes for customization
Cons
- Dated user interface lacking modern design elements
- Slower development pace with infrequent major updates
- Mod installation can introduce compatibility issues
Best For
Budget-conscious admins of small to medium communities seeking a reliable, highly customizable forum without modern UI polish.
vBulletin
enterprisevBulletin provides a commercial forum solution with powerful moderation, SEO tools, and scalability for large communities.
Integrated CMS and social networking modules for turning forums into full community websites
vBulletin is a mature, commercial PHP-based forum software renowned for powering large-scale online discussion communities since the early 2000s. It provides threaded conversations, advanced user management, moderation tools, private messaging, and extensive customization via templates and add-ons. While scalable and feature-packed, its traditional design and slower update cycle make it less competitive against modern open-source alternatives.
Pros
- Robust feature set including CMS, blogs, and social tools
- Proven scalability for high-traffic forums
- Extensive third-party modifications and templates
Cons
- Dated interface lacking modern responsive design
- Expensive licensing with ongoing annual fees
- Infrequent major updates and slower development
Best For
Established medium-to-large communities needing a reliable, customizable traditional forum platform.
